TECHNICAL FIELD
[0001] The utility model relates to the technical field of tobacco industry and mechanical manufacturing processing industry especially relates to a kind of anti-smoke clamping devices of intelligent packing machine. BACKGROUND
[0002] Tobacco intelligent packing equipment is directly cooperated with packer and packer to carry out pack, push pack and other actions, but there is a certain gap between packer and pack outlet position in this process, and during the process of pushing compacted tobacco, tobacco is clamped into gap, which leads to the phenomenon that part of tobacco is clamped off, finally leading to the condition that tobacco package weight reduces;Therefore, an anti-smoke clamping device of intelligent packing machine is proposed. DETAILED DESCRIPTION
[0017] The following is a specific embodiment of the utility model, and the technical scheme of the utility model is further described in combination with the drawings, but the utility model is not limited to these embodiments.
[0018] A tobacco blocking prevention device of an intelligent packing machine, comprising a packing machine 1, the packing machine 1 is provided with a bearing space 2, the bearing space 2 can bear a tobacco package truck 3 to enter, a weighing platform and a package pressing mechanism 5 are arranged in the bearing space 2 to weigh and compact the material in the tobacco package truck 3, lifting doors 8 are arranged on both sides of the tobacco package truck 3, the lifting doors 8 are also provided with lifting edges 6, the lifting edges 6 are matched with lifting mechanisms 7 to open the lifting doors 8, a package pushing pipe 9 for the entry and exit of the material is mounted on the side wall of the packing machine 1, the bearing space 2 is also provided with a telescopic arm 10, the bearing space 2 is also provided with a tobacco blocking prevention device for the smooth passing of the material during package pushing, the tobacco blocking prevention device comprises a package pushing opening 12 arranged at one end of the package pushing pipe 9 and an auxiliary edge 11 matched with the package pushing opening 12 of the tobacco package truck 3.
[0019] The bearing space 2 of the packing machine 1 can accommodate the cigarette cart 3 to enter to implement the weighing and extrusion operation on the cigarette cart 3 and the material loaded therein; the lifting door 8 is arranged on both sides of the cigarette cart 3, and the opening of the lifting door 8 depends on the cooperation of the lifting edge 6 on the door side and the lifting mechanism 7; the lifting mechanism 7 drives the lifting edge 6 to open the lifting door 8 after being started; the push pack pipe 9 arranged on the side wall of the packing machine 1 is a channel for the material to enter and exit; the telescopic arm 10 arranged in the bearing space 2 is responsible for pushing the material in the cigarette cart 3 to the push pack pipe 9 after the side door of the cigarette cart 3 is opened; and the anti-pinch device of the bearing space 2 is particularly crucial, which is composed of the push pack opening 12 arranged at one end of the push pack pipe 9 and the auxiliary edge 11 matched with the push pack opening 12; the device can ensure that the material flows smoothly during the pushing process, effectively avoids the material from being pinched, guarantees the smooth operation of the material transportation and packing work, and effectively avoids the decrease of the weight of the material after weighing.
[0020] The push pack opening 12 arranged at one end of the push pack pipe 9 is in the shape of an outer horn.
[0021] The push pack opening 12 arranged at one end of the push pack pipe 9 is in the shape of an outer horn, which can better guide the material, and the cooperation of the auxiliary edge 11 enables the telescopic arm 10 to smoothly push the material from the cigarette cart 3 to the push pack pipe 9, thereby effectively guaranteeing that the weight of the material after weighing will not decrease.
[0022] The push pack opening 9 is provided with a notch 13, and the notch 13 is used for the radial passage of the auxiliary edge 11.
[0023] The specific notch 13 arranged on the push pack opening 9 enables the auxiliary edge 11 fixed to the bottom of the cigarette cart 3 to pass radially smoothly when the cigarette cart 3 is pushed into the bearing space 2, so as to facilitate the subsequent work; when the cigarette cart 3 enters the bearing space 2, the auxiliary edge 11 is above the lower edge of the push pack opening 12, and when the telescopic arm 10 pushes the material into the push pack pipe 9, the material will not be blocked or reduced due to the push pack opening 12.
[0024] The lifting mechanism 7 comprises lifting frames 14 arranged on both sides of the bearing space 2, and the lifting frames 14 are provided with air cylinders 15 below; when the air cylinders 15 are raised, the side door of the cigarette cart 3 is opened, and the telescopic arm 10 can push the material in the cigarette cart 3 to the push pack pipe 9.
[0025] The lifting frames 14 are arranged on both sides of the bearing space 2 of the packing machine 1, and the air cylinders 15 are arranged below the lifting frames 14; when the air cylinders 15 start to work and are raised, the force generated thereby can drive the side door of the cigarette cart 3 to open; at this time, the telescopic arm 10 below the bearing space 2 can push the material in the cigarette cart 3 to the push pack pipe 9 smoothly; during the whole process, the air cylinders 15 and the lifting frames 14 work cooperatively to accurately control the opening of the side door of the cigarette cart 3, thereby creating conditions for the subsequent pushing operation of the material.
[0026] The push bag pipe 9 is provided with clamping devices outside the four sides.
[0027] In operation, the packing bag is sleeved outside the four sides of the push bag pipe 9, and the clamping devices are used to fix the packing bag, so as to prevent the packing bag from falling off when the telescopic arm 10 pushes the material into the push bag pipe 9 for packing, and to affect the work efficiency.
[0028] The use process of the anti-pinch device of the intelligent packing machine 1 is as follows: in operation, the tobacco bale vehicle 3 first enters the bearing space 2 provided with the weighing platform and the pack pressing mechanism 5, and the material is weighed and compacted in the bearing space 2. Then, the lifting edges 6 on the two sides of the lifting door 8 of the tobacco bale vehicle 3 are opened under the action of the lifting mechanism 7, at this time, the telescopic arm 10 in the bearing space 2 is started to push the material in the tobacco bale vehicle 3 to the push bag pipe 9 on the side wall of the packing machine 1, and in this process, the anti-pinch device plays a key role, the push bag opening 12 at one end of the push bag pipe 9 cooperates with the auxiliary edge 11 of the tobacco bale vehicle 3, so as to ensure that the material smoothly passes through the push bag pipe 9, avoid the material being pinched, and until the whole material packing process is completed.
